Common Lawn Sprinkler Head Issues
Lawn sprinkler heads can encounter a selection of usual problems that affect their efficiency. One regular trouble is obstructing, which occurs when mineral, particles, or dust buildup blocks the nozzle. To repair this, you can eliminate the head and tidy it thoroughly. One more problem is incorrect alignment; heads might obtain knocked out of setting, resulting in irregular watering. You can adjust them back to their appropriate angles to ensure proper insurance coverage. Furthermore, split or broken heads can cause leaks and lowered pressure. Change the head without delay if you detect any type of damages. Sometimes, the pop-up device can malfunction, causing the head to stay stuck. In such cases, check for any kind of particles or damage in the device. Regular upkeep and examinations can assist you capture these problems early, maintaining your automatic sprinkler running smoothly and effectively.

Check Sprinkler Head Placement
Inspecting the alignment of your sprinkler heads is vital for maintaining an also water circulation throughout your grass. Misaligned heads can result in over-saturated areas or dry patches, wasting water and harming your turf. Begin by activating your system and observing the spray pattern. If you see any type of heads spraying in the wrong instructions or missing out on locations, it's time to readjust. Delicately spin or rearrange the sprinkler heads so they aim towards the locations that need insurance coverage. Validate they go to the proper height, too-- heads buried as well reduced won't disperse water effectively. After making changes, run your system once again to confirm that all areas receive proper insurance coverage. Normal checks like this can significantly enhance your grass's health.

Fixing Malfunctioning Shutoffs
When your lawn sprinkler system's valves begin to malfunction, it can interrupt your entire irrigation setup, resulting in dry patches in your grass or overwatering in some areas. To tackle this problem, initially, locate the shutoff that's causing troubles. Check for visible indications of damage, like fractures or leaks. If the valve seems stuck, you can delicately tap it to see if it maximizes.
After reassembling, turn the water back on and evaluate the shutoff. Make certain it's opening and closing properly. website Think about changing the whole shutoff to recover your system's performance. if it still doesn't work.
Keeping Your Lawn Sprinkler for Long Life
To ensure your automatic sprinkler lasts for many years, it's vital to perform regular maintenance. Begin by evaluating your system frequently for leakages or damaged parts. Even a small leakage can lose water and raise your costs. Adjust the spray heads to verify they're targeting your lawn and not the walkway.
Following, tidy the filters and nozzles to avoid blockages that can interfere with water flow. You need to additionally look for any obstructions, like dirt or particles, that might obstruct water from reaching more info your plants.
Do not forget to adjust your watering schedule seasonally; this keeps your landscape healthy without overwatering. Additionally, take into consideration winterizing your system if you reside in chillier climates to avoid cold damage.

How Commonly Should I Check My Automatic Sprinkler?
You should check your automatic sprinkler a minimum of two times a year, ideally in spring and autumn. Regular checks help determine leakages, clogs, or damaged parts, ensuring your system works effectively and maintains your landscape healthy.
Can I Winterize My Automatic Sprinkler Myself?
Yes, you can winterize your lawn sprinkler on your own. Just drain the pipes, impact out the lines with an air compressor, and insulate revealed parts. It's an more info uncomplicated process that'll secure your system from cold damages.
What Devices Do I Required for Sprinkler Repair Works?
For lawn sprinkler fixings, you'll need a few vital devices: a wrench, pliers, a screwdriver collection, Teflon tape, and an utility blade. Having these on hand makes repairing leaks or replacing parts a lot easier.
